Epson printers are designed with a maintenance protection system. During cleaning cycles and print jobs, a small amount of ink is flushed into a waste ink pad inside the printer to prevent clogging. To prevent this pad from overflowing and leaking ink, the printer software counts these cleaning cycles.

During routine head cleaning cycles, a monochrome printer channels excess ink away from the system. This waste ink is stored in physically porous pads at the base of the machine.
You must reset this digital counter back to 0% using a resetter tool.
